IMO it is too early to get either too bullish or too bearish.
Clearly, this team is much better than last year's team and we have seen effective passing, long stretches of good defense and stretches of good perimeter shooting.
With a sample size of three games and two exhibitions, against decent but not strong competition, it is hard to definitively comment about consistency...but, we have had players look outstanding in two games and so-so in one.
AB has incrementally improved in some areas but still is weak in areas where he was weak. Kelis Fisher has made some good plays as well, but both have finished poorly on some plays.
Our two frosh have made some great plays and show promise, but also miss some defensive assignments.
The most promising point is that this is a TEAM and they clearly pull together.

Here's the bottom line on Brimah on defense... Post defense begins and ends with positioning. The post defender has to fight for position and deny the offensive player's ability to setup where ever they like, especially in the lane, 3 feet from the hoop. Brimah is ABYSMAL at this. I'm not sure if he's just so in love with blocked shots that he doesn't try, doesn't know that, or what. So far the bigs from small conference teams have eaten his lunch setting up wherever they like in the lane. That kind of effort on defense will be that much worse facing a quality post player.
